The Karnataka Common Entrance Test (KCET) for 2026 is underway. The exam began on April 22 and concludes on April 24 . It is administered by the Karnataka Education Authority (KEA). The test is for admission to undergraduate programs. These include engineering, pharmacy, and agriculture courses across Karnataka.

KCET 2026 Exam Schedule

The KCET is conducted over several days. Each day includes specific subjects and time slots. Candidates take the Kannada Language Test first.

DateSessionTimingSubjectMarks
April 22, 2026Morning10:30 AM - 11:30 AMKannada Language Test50
April 23, 2026Morning10:30 AM - 11:50 AMPhysics60
April 23, 2026Afternoon02:30 PM - 03:50 PMChemistry60
April 24, 2026Morning10:30 AM - 11:50 AMMathematics60
April 24, 2026Afternoon02:30 PM - 03:50 PMBiology60
